I have encountered the bug in the KDE ( see subject ) and found that
it is a known bug and has existed since KDE 3.x (not sure of the exact
version).

I have a snapshot of the window show the exact bug & I've used GNU
Paint to edit the PNG image to show how I think a new button could be
added to the form -- to recreate the missing index file.

Bug report :

http://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=101876

Hello KDE people,

The attachment is a snapshot of the window, showing the bug -- which I have
edited with GNU Paint, to add a "button".

What I'm proposing is that a new button with the caption of "Recreate
Missing
Index" be added to the form -- please refer to the attached PNG file.

I'm only a newbie at Linux and Kubuntu (& KDE 4.0)... However, I thought
that
this bug called for some lateral thinking. If the index file is missing,
then
to my way of thinking, why not have a button to click on to recreate it. The

way I see it the software needs to have enough 'SMARTS' to know:

(a) what the filename of the missing index file should be.
(b) the path to recreate the missing index file.
& (c) what needs to written to the new index file (e.g. what it should
include)


I don't have enough understanding of how Kubuntu or KDE works... but maybe
someone else does.
